Funny, a year ago Hakstol was a Jack Adams consideration who had taken a new expansion franchise to the Stanley Cup playoff in just one year. However, the team takes a step back this year and that's it for Hakstol. It's a tough business. Personally, I think the regression is more on the players than the coach, but it don't work that way (:
There is no shortage of HC vacancies out there, it will be interesting to see if Hakstol can immediately land another job or not.
